General Dynamics Secures $395M DHS Data Center Support Extension

General Dynamics‘ (NYSE: GD) information technology business will continue to provide managed hosting and professional services to a Department of Homeland Security-owned data center under a potential 18-month, $395.5 million indefinite-delivery/​indefinite-quantity contract.

An award notice posted Thursday on SAM.gov says GDIT will extend its operations support at the DHS Enterprise Data Center 1 while the department is preparing its new Data Center and Cloud Optimization contract.

DHS expects to complete the DCCO contracting process in the fourth quarter of fiscal year 2021.

The department started its formal solicitation process for the upcoming 10-year, $3.35B acquisition program that will encompass enterprise data center, colocation and cloud services to hybrid computing infrastructure.
